You should not to take worry if you don’t have Note 5 or S6 and you will be able to use Samsung Pay in the United States very soon. The global co-general manager Thomas Ko said to Reuters that mobile payment service would possibly make its technique to lower-priced Samsung phones in the next year 2016. He added that it is not all and the online payment support will be available very soon. Reuters also added that it would become a direct services competitor such as PayPal, but it is possible when the mobile wallet initialize to accept online payments.
Thomas Ko further said that unluckily, but he didn’t talk about on any piece of information. We cannot say either Samsung Pay has any plan to expand it outside the United States. James Wester from IDC Financial Insights also informed to Reuters that moving online is being considered an efficient and smart move for Samsung Company. He added that a number of people are not interested in this idea of mobile payments and they prefer to use credit cards and considering more convenient way. Samsung can also enhance customer experience by translating more transactions for mobile wallet.
